WebBand-aid Mod, Defined. Band-aid mod on RAMA Works KOYU Mechanical Keyboard from MMORPG Blog “Band-aiding” one’s keyboard involves applying a small cut-up piece of band-aid under a stabilizer slot to cushion a keyboard’s stabilizer. The band-aid mod eliminates the rattly sound and feel of keys with supporting stabilizers, such as the ...
